Foros del Web » Programación para mayores de 30 ;) » C/C++ »

Ayuda Coredump.!!!!

Estas en el tema de Ayuda Coredump.!!!! en el foro de C/C++ en Foros del Web. Hola amigos del foro, espero me puedan ayudar, le cuento mi problema.... aqui les muestro mi codigo... Leo desde un archivo tres parametros que estan ...
  #1 (permalink)  
Antiguo 15/05/2006, 19:07
 
Fecha de Ingreso: enero-2005
Mensajes: 103
Antigüedad: 19 años, 4 meses
Puntos: 0
Ayuda Coredump.!!!!

Hola amigos del foro, espero me puedan ayudar, le cuento mi problema.... aqui les muestro mi codigo...

Leo desde un archivo tres parametros que estan separado por ";" y los dejo en 3 variables hasta ahi todo ok..

iCtdCols = 3;

do{
iArchNotCred = fscanf(fileArchNotCred,"%[^;];%[^;];[^\n]\n", cCodTipDocumNC, cValTotalDR, cCodRecupIva);

if ((iArchNotCred == EOF) || (iArchNotCred == 0)) break;
else if (iArchNotCred != iCtdCols)
{
iError = 1;
break;
}

}while (iArchNotCred > 0);

Cuando el archivo es menor a 2MB no hay ningun problema.. pero si este sobrepasa los 2MB se cae y me dice error Coredump... alguien me puede ayudar o dar alguna idea de que puedo hacer para solucionar este problema..??


Saludos y gracias por vuestra ayuda...
Roberto.
  #2 (permalink)  
Antiguo 16/05/2006, 09:14
Avatar de Instru  
Fecha de Ingreso: noviembre-2002
Ubicación: Mexico
Mensajes: 2.751
Antigüedad: 21 años, 6 meses
Puntos: 52
Y como abres el archivo?
Saludos
  #3 (permalink)  
Antiguo 17/05/2006, 07:55
 
Fecha de Ingreso: enero-2005
Mensajes: 103
Antigüedad: 19 años, 4 meses
Puntos: 0
al abrir el archivo(se abre con el parametro r, de lectura) no hay ningun problema... lee las lineas como corresponde....como les decia lee hasta aproximadamente 1MB pero si sobrepaso 1MB se cae....

Alguna idea de que puede ser??

Saludos y gracias por responder
Roberto.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 14:48.